The answer to whether the frosting or the cake is better largely depends on personal preference. Some individuals prefer the richness and sweetness of frosting, which can be seen as the highlight due to its creamy texture and the variety of flavors it offers. Others might value the cake itself more, appreciating its moistness, flavor, and the base it provides for the frosting. Generally, the synergy between cake and frosting can create an ideal balance, with each complementing the other to enhance the overall flavor and experience. Ultimately, determining the ‘better’ component comes down to individual tastes, dietary preferences, and the specific recipe or flavor used. Some might enjoy a thicker layer of frosting, while others might prefer a denser or lighter sponge for the cake.
